That chord is tough!!! For me, I mostly ignore the high E string (leave it open, don’t strum it, or have the left or right hand lightly touching it to keep it muted when strummed). I mostly focus on the next 3 strings (from the bottom)…. Pointer on the first fret of the B string, middle finger on the 2nd fret of the G string, and ring finger on the 3rd fret of the D string.
That’s how I like to play the F chord if I’m not doing a full barre chord.
